Pirate girls blow out Bearcats soccer
By Cort Reynolds
The visiting Bluffton High School girls soccer team dominated Spencerville 6-0 in the Northwest Conference opener Tuesday evening, August 30.
Allison Diller and Sami Scoles each scored two goals to pace the Pirate offense. Diller also passed out two assists.
The lopsided win lifted the Pirate record to 3-0 overall and 1-0 in NWC play. The Bearcat girls fell to 0-3 overall and 0-1 in the NWC with the defeat.
Jasi Crawfis scored the game's first goal in the 18th minute on a pass from Blair Utendorf.
Diller made it 2-0 just before halftime on a goal from an Ella Armstrong assist.
Scoles made it 3-0 in the 47th minute off a feed from Diller.
Riley Eachus found the back of the net in the 69th minute unassisted.
Diller scored again two minutes later from an Eachus pass to extend the margin to 5-0. Scoles then closed the scoring with a goal in the 73rd minute via a Diller feed.
The Pirates peppered the Bearcats with 35 shots, 22 of which were on goal.
The Bearcats got off just two shots, both on goal.
Pirate keeper Julia Mehaffie made two saves in goal, while the Spencerville keeper made 22 stops.
Bluffton hosts Van Buren (4-1) Thursday evening and entertains Coldwater (3-2) Saturday night in a pair of non-league bouts.
